Hi all — welcome aboard! Quick handover for SproutCycle, our plant-watering scheduler. Releases go out Thursdays; the pipeline is mostly hands-off, but you'll need to sign the build manually until we automate it next quarter. Maren left notes in the runbook. For now, the deploy key you'll use is right here.

rollout seal: bky4_x7Gc

**Minutes — Currency Hedging Decision, Ravensholt Trading**

Circulated to sales leads. The committee reviewed exposure arising from expanded exports to the Varnia region and approved forward contracts covering approximately 70% of projected receipts for the next two quarters. Pricing sheets will be updated to reflect hedged rates. Please quote accordingly. The confidential business-planning note follows immediately below.

management briefing: Wenoxix Freight is in early talks to buy Quenokix Freight for about $107.5 million. The Praok launch date is September 23, and nothing goes to the press before then. Legal wants the Oliathax Holdings term sheet signed before June 16.

Subject: Driver-assignment heuristic review — Fleetwise Dispatch

Hi Rovana integration team,

Before you review the pull request, note that the new heuristic weights driver proximity at 0.6 and shift-remaining time at 0.4, replacing the flat round-robin. Ties break on lowest active-job count. Edge case: drivers flagged on-break are excluded entirely, so staging data must include at least two available drivers. To exercise the assignment endpoint against our sandbox, authenticate with the token below.

portal login ticket: eyJhbGciOiJIUzI1NiIsInR5cCI6IkpXVCJ9.eyJzdWIiOiIwEOsktwVNwIn0.-UJU3fdyyCgG

## Service accounts: Marrowfield SFTP drop

Welcome! The partner drop from Marrowfield runs under the `svc-marrow-pull` account, which only has read access to their outbound folder — please don't request broader scopes. Files land in our staging bucket via the internal Ferrypost service, and that's the one piece you'll authenticate against during setup. The Ferrypost key you should use for local testing is below.

app token of tagef-tafog = qvz3-7n0